Systems Analyst

"I loved every minute of my career at Boeing, amazing company. I was hungry to learn and they fed me as much as I was willing to eat."

What do you like about working at Boeing?

"Diversity in career opportunities. Ability to grow and develop skills across the enterprise. Great people."

Do you have any tips for others interviewing with this company?

"Personality matters. If you are looking for just another job, then this isn't a good fit. Boeing is a company that offers you a career with a lot of mobility and growth potential. If change scares you, then it will be a struggle."

What don't you like about working at Boeing?

"Cycles of lay-offs. While never impacted because it is a manufacturing company with strong unions, it was difficult during union contract negotiations and during mfg. slow-downs."

What suggestions do you have for management?

"Continue to help people move around to get exposed to a large company and multiple systems. Continue to keep their career goals in mind. Make reviews more meaningful instead of just a task to be accomplished."

Electronic Systems Engineer

"There is a high level of responsibility working there and to me that was a good thing."

What do you like about working at Boeing?

"They have a lot of real engineering opportunities in a variety of fields related to their commercial and military projects. One can really apply oneself to solving difficult problems and continuously improve one's technical and leadership skills."

Do you have any tips for others interviewing with this company?

"It's a good place to work. Managers and Lead Engineers are understanding of the challenges you face and willing to discuss your work with you and listen to become aware of progress and the risks new projects have."

What don't you like about working at Boeing?

"There are a great deal of new major projects and this requires one to be really flexible to upper management changes in priority."

What suggestions do you have for management?

"Focus on completing a single set of goals for the company's future."
